Leighton Buzzard To Banbury

Please note that these route pages are a work in progress. The figures below indicate route length; however, not all locks and bridges are included currently, so the time required may be underestimated.

Departure Point:

"Leighton Buzzard, Bedfordshire Hire Base", Rothschild Road, Linslade, Leighton Buzzard, Bedfordshire, LU7 2TF

 
Cruising Hours: This route consists of 146.234 miles, 96 locks and 4 tunnels. Which will take 10 days, 1 hour and 14 minutes when travelling for 7 hours per day at our default speeds.
